What is the transition to motherhood called?

In short, just as adolescence describes a teenager's passage into adulthood, matrescence describes a woman's transition into motherhood and all the psychological and physical change that comes with it. It begins during pregnancy and continues after the baby is born.

What's the meaning of matrescence?

/mæˈtres. ənts/ the process of becoming a mother: Those physical, psychological and emotional changes you go through after the birth of your child now have a name: matrescence. The process of becoming a mother, which anthropologists call “matrescence”,,” has been largely unexplored in the medical community.

Do babies come from the father or mother?

To form a fetus, an egg from the mother and sperm from the father come together. The egg and sperm each have one half of a set of chromosomes. The egg and sperm together give the baby the full set of chromosomes. So, half the baby's DNA comes from the mother and half comes from the father.

How do they call a woman who has just given birth?

A woman who has just given birth to a baby is termed, Puerpera. Primigravida is a woman who has conceived pregnancy for the first time. Parturient is the woman who is about to give birth.
